Stuffed Acorn Squash with Sausage

This savory pork dish brings rich flavor to the table and pairs well with bright or crisp sides.

Stuffed Acorn Squash with Sausage recipe
Prep15
Cook30
Total45
Servings2

Ingredients

  • 1 acorn squash, halved and seeded
  • 6 oz chicken sausage
  • 1/4 cup dry quinoa
  • 1/2 cup water or broth
  • 1/4 cup diced onion
  • 1/4 cup diced celery
  • 1 tsp olive oil
  • Salt and black pepper, to taste

Instructions

  1. Heat the oven to 400°F.
  2. Place the squash halves cut-side down on a sheet pan and roast for about 30 minutes, until tender.
  3. Meanwhile, rinse the quinoa.
  4. Combine the quinoa with the water or broth in a small saucepan and bring to a boil. Cover and simmer for 12 to 15 minutes, until tender.
  5. Heat the olive oil in a skillet over medium heat.
  6. Remove the sausage from the casing if needed, then cook it with the onion and celery for 5 to 6 minutes, until browned and cooked through.
  7. Stir the cooked quinoa into the sausage mixture and season to taste.
  8. Fill the roasted squash halves with the mixture and serve warm.

Gourmet Geek Tip

Scoop out the seeds before roasting so the cavity is ready for filling. | Roast the squash until fork-tender but still firm enough to hold the filling. | Serve with a simple green salad.
